Output 2783b23b2463ecdb66fce8552eb65531c8d5d38bf2efccceee94902aed35f3e1:0

value
17021259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d7e52de1dc3e70bb94d3f3b81a468482c6c4426 OP_EQUAL
address
37JAUNRCSFQYFq8vskVFeorXHWzsoPv6kP
transaction
2783b23b2463ecdb66fce8552eb65531c8d5d38bf2efccceee94902aed35f3e1
spent
true